Section 3 - Connect to a Wireless Network

Connect to a Wireless Network

Wi-Fi Protected Setup (WPS) System is designed for easy setup of security-enabled Wi-Fi networks. It is recommended to have the access point or
wireless router nearby during setup.
"Push Button Configuration" (PBC) is a physical button on the DWA-140 and most wireless devices such as routers. A connection can be established
by pressing the WPS button on the DWA-140 and then pushing the button on your access point or wireless router within 120 seconds.
1. Press the WPS button located on your wireless router or access point.
Please refer to the user manual of your router or access point if you
do not know how to start the WPS process.

2. To connect to your network, press the WPS button on the adapter
and hold for two seconds. Allow up to two minutes for the devices
to connect.
